Here are a few steps that could help develop and deal with change.

  1. Identify what change area is influencing you
  2. Learn about the changes that are taking place in the area.
  3. Assess how these changes are affecting you
  4. What are the possible affects of those changes.
  5. What you must change in youurself to deal with it, dont try to avert change as u will fail
  6. Do read alot, and try implementing the alternatives to deal with change,
  7. Keep on reflecting on your implementations, and ask yourself
  • What went well
  • What went wrong
  • What could have been done differently
  • How would it be done differently.
